Ralph Shepard 1603–1693 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 3 June 1603

Birth Location: Derbyshire, England

Death Date: 12 September 1693

Death Location: Malden, Middlesex, MA, USA

Father: Isaac Sheaphearde

Mother: Margaret **

Spouse(s): Thanklorde Perkins

Children(s): John Shepherd

In 1603, Ralph Shepard entered the world in Derbyshire, England, born to Isaac Shepard Or Sheaphearde And Margaret Ann Hillewell Holliwell. Ralph Shepard married Thanklorde Thanks Perkins, and had children including John Shepherd. Ralph Shepard passed away in 1693 in Malden, Middlesex, MA, USA.
